Formule EXCEL

Résolu
DANA1803 Messages postés 4 Date d'inscription   Statut Membre Dernière intervention   -  
DANA1803 Messages postés 4 Date d'inscription   Statut Membre Dernière intervention   - 16 août 2019 à 15:29
Bonjour,

J'ai fait une recherche V mais malheusement il faut que les cellules soient identiques.

Quel est la formule suivante svp:

Exemple:

Tableau 1:

celllule A: designation produit + référence produit
Cellule B : Quantité commandés

Tableau 2:

cellule A: référence produit
Cellule B : (formule qui retrouve la quantité commandé de la référence produit dans le tableau 1)

J'ai fait une recherche V mais ça n'as pas marché car la cellule A du Tableau 1 contient référence produit et n'est pas égale à référence produit du tableau 2.

2 réponses

via55 Messages postés 14512 Date d'inscription   Statut Membre Dernière intervention   2 742
 
Bonjour

1° ton tableau enfreint une des règles de base d'une BDD : une info par cellule, il faudrait une colonne pour la désignation et une colonne pour la référence

2° Pour pallier cela il faut inclure dans ta recherchev qu’il peut y avoir n'importe quoi avant la ref avec le signe *
Pour chercher par ex la ref 145G ta formule est :
=RECHERCHEV("*" & "145G";A:B;2;0)

Cdlmnt
Via
1
DANA1803 Messages postés 4 Date d'inscription   Statut Membre Dernière intervention  
 
Mais j'ai plusieurs lignes de référence. Donc comment faire? car je peut pas remettre la référence en question pour chaque cellule.

Merci.
0
via55 Messages postés 14512 Date d'inscription   Statut Membre Dernière intervention   2 742
 
Re,

Tout dépend de ce que tu veux obtenir :

- soit le montant pour une réf que tu peux changer; à ce moment mettre la référence dans une cellule par ex G1 et la formule devient =RECHERCHEV("*" & G1;A:B;2;0) quand tu changes la ref en G1 le résultat change en fonction

- soit les montants pour toutes les références; alors il faut faire la liste des références en colonne G par ex, en H1 mettre la même formule que celle indiquée ci dessus et l'étirer au bas de la colonne

Si c'est autre chose précise davantage ce que tu veux et poste un exemple de ton fichier sur mon-partage.fr, copié le lien créé et reviens le coller ici

Cdlmnt
1
DANA1803 Messages postés 4 Date d'inscription   Statut Membre Dernière intervention  
 
RECHERCHEV("*"&B191;[19AC06_HSMatérielHSD.xls]Feuil2!$A$2:$C$609;3;0)

Voici ce que j'ai fait, mais cela me met une non valeur?!
0
DANA1803 Messages postés 4 Date d'inscription   Statut Membre Dernière intervention  
 
Re,

YOUPII. ça a marché. j'ai retrouvé une de tes anciennes réponses d'un autre forum qui avait le même problème que moi et en faite il fallait que je rajoutes &"*" après B191.

Merci BEAUCCOOUUPPP!!!
0